Early Life

Tino Best, born on August 26, 1981, in Barbados, was destined for a successful cricket career from a young age. Growing up in a family with a strong cricketing background, Best was exposed to the sport early on. His uncle, Carlisle Best, a former West Indies batsman, played a crucial role in shaping Best's interest in cricket.
